Holland America Line begins 2026 Alaska season with Eurodam, 100+ sailings, new excursions, and Teen Ranger program.

Holland America Line launches its 2026 Alaska season tomorrow with Eurodam's arrival in Seattle. The cruise operator will deploy six ships across more than 100 sailings throughout the season. The line has developed 25 new shore excursions, including guided floatplane and hiking experiences to Norris Glacier in Juneau and moose discovery tours in Anchorage. All Alaska itineraries feature a Glacier Day stop at destinations such as Endicott Arm or Dawes Glacier. Holland America is introducing a Teen Ranger program across its Alaska fleet, providing specialized activities for passengers aged 13-17 during Glacier Day visits. The company emphasizes fresh seafood offerings and cultural experiences as core elements of the expanded program.
